Westhoughton has a good selection of amenities. In addition to the local shops and eateries, there’s also a bank, hairdressers, market hall and several supermarkets for the weekly shop. For more shopping options, nearby Middlebrook retail park in Horwich is home to a wide variety of shops, restaurants and a cinema.
This superb location means you’ll be within easy reach of many destinations, including Middlebrook and Leigh less than 5 miles away, Wigan 6.5 miles away, and Manchester around 16 miles away. Westhoughton train station offers quick services into Bolton, while Daisy Hill train operates direct services to Manchester Victoria. The area is also well connected by local bus routes.
There’s no shortage of activities and outdoor pursuits in and around Westhoughton. The local Community Leisure Centre offers sports for all ages to enjoy, including gymnastics, football, swimming and even archery. Golfers will enjoy the proximity to two courses, and you’ll also find a riding school, cycling club and trampoline park – there’s truly something for everyone.
Families living at Kingswood will benefit from a selection of schooling options nearby. Primary schools include The Gates Primary School and Nursery, Sacred Heart Primary, and St Bartholomew’s C of E Primary School. For secondary education there’s Westhoughton High, while Bolton College is close by and provides a range of further education courses.
